Output eb2c18a46ceccf77810dd50ea35a9fa83795fa648459442e5e73008161e94cde:0

value
1582718538
script pubkey
OP_0 OP_PUSHBYTES_20 3dde97c040ef55cd7a33c195552745c58c12c0d2
address
tb1q8h0f0szqaa2u673ncx242f69ckxp9sxjxgen0l
transaction
eb2c18a46ceccf77810dd50ea35a9fa83795fa648459442e5e73008161e94cde
confirmations
105028
spent
true